Output 5333216e2335738afbf02eb79d7d28d845831558121844a7acf31f8fc75b8ed1:77

value
1737900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 658434bf6c7fd9166a5e1be61df0033fdafb3676 OP_EQUAL
address
3AwnYknYM4874eqMBLmXHtTTprPkvHg6pn
transaction
5333216e2335738afbf02eb79d7d28d845831558121844a7acf31f8fc75b8ed1
spent
true